Manufacturing Process
We follow a precision-controlled casting process to produce safe, leak-proof safety valve components. Every step is optimized to ensure reliability and long-term performance.
Optimized Mold Design: Guarantees uniform cavity shapes and accurate dimensions
Controlled Metal Flow: Reduces turbulence, porosity, and shrinkage defects
Stress-Relieving Heat Treatment: Improves toughness, durability, and structural integrity
High-Precision Machining: Ensures smooth sealing surfaces and exact tolerances
Comprehensive Inspection: Dimensional, visual, and functional checks for secure, reliable operation
Testing & Compliance
We ensure every safety valve casting meets international quality, performance, and safety standards through rigorous testing:
Dimensional Verification: CMM, calipers, and gauges for precise body, spring, and disc alignment
Non-Destructive Testing (NDT): Dye Penetrant, X-ray, and Ultrasonic inspection for internal and surface defects
Mechanical & Metallurgical Tests: Hardness, tensile strength, yield strength, elongation, and microstructure analysis
Functional Testing: Pressure relief operation, disc and spring performance, hydrostatic pressure, and air tightness tests
Corrosion & Surface Testing: Coating adhesion, passivation quality, and optional salt spray testing
Standards Compliance: API 520 / 526, ASTM, ASME, DIN, EN, BS, JIS

What Is Safety Valve Casting? & Why Investment Casting Is the Right Method?
A safety valve is a critical pressure-relief device installed in boilers, pressure vessels, pipelines, and industrial systems to automatically release excess pressure and prevent catastrophic failure. The body, bonnet, disc, and nozzle of a safety valve must withstand sudden pressure surges, high temperatures, and chemically aggressive media, making material selection and dimensional accuracy non-negotiable.
Investment casting, also called lost wax casting, is the manufacturing method of choice for safety valve components because it produces near-net-shape parts with complex internal geometries, smooth sealing surfaces, and tight dimensional tolerances in a single production step. Compared to sand casting, investment casting delivers a superior surface finish (Ra 3.2-6.3 µm as-cast vs Ra 12.5+ µm in sand casting) and better dimensional accuracy, critical for the seat and disc sealing surfaces of a safety valve, where even minor surface irregularity causes leakage at set pressure.
